Supporting migrants and refugees in the European labour market – challenges for workers' organisations

Lublin / PL

This seminar aims to address the current situation of migrants and refugees in Europe, with a focus on labour migrants. It will examine the challenges they face, such as complex work permit procedures, dismissals, wage reductions, labour market discrimination, and deficiencies in education and skills. A key discussion point will be the integration of refugees and migrants into society and the labour market, as well as the role of workers' organisations in supporting this process.

The seminar will debate the professional and educational situation of migrants and refugees and explore good practices for their activation in the labour market. Representatives of workers' organisations from different EU countries will exchange experiences on integrating labour migrants socially, culturally, linguistically, and professionally. Discussions will focus on supporting foreign workers, preventing illegal practices, ensuring their legal rights, and effectively communicating their importance to economic development.

The project will seek to strengthen cooperation between workers' organisations, promote the role of workers’ organisations in dialogue on integration processes, and build plans for short- and long-term collaboration. The seminar also aims to enhance dialogue and experience-sharing between workers' organisations and local and national authorities, contributing to more effective integration strategies.
